Deoban Forest Rest House is a serene retreat located in the dense forests of Jadi, Uttarakhand, offering a peaceful and immersive nature experience. Established in 1954 and situated at an elevation of 2,814 meters, it is ideal for nature lovers, trekkers, and those seeking solitude. The rest house provides basic amenities and serves as a gateway to nearby attractions like Vyas Shikhar and alpine meadows. While the location is remote and the road conditions can be challenging, the tranquility and scenic beauty make it a rewarding destination for adventurous travelers.

Worth knowing
- Poor road conditions to the rest house, requiring a 4x4 or SUV for safe travel
- Limited on-site facilities and amenities, including no electricity on weekends
- No nearby shops or restaurants, requiring guests to bring their own food and supplies
